Job Description

Job DescriptionGeneral Summary:The Managed Care Contracting Associate Director will provide leadership and management oversight of Market Access Contract processes by facilitating negotiation and administration of all Payer, Provider and Trade & Distribution contracts. This person will partner with, among others, Account Management, Finance, Government Pricing & Rebate Operations, GTN, Legal, Marketing and Payer Marketing to ensure appropriate identification and evaluation of contracting opportunities. These responsibilities will apply across all Vertex marketed product lines and pipeline products.Key Duties and Responsibilities:Manage the end-to-end Payer contract development process, including working with cross-functional partners on pre-deal analytics, negotiations, and post-deal analytics as well as the logging, tracking, reporting and facilitation of contract opportunities through the governance, negotiation/redlining and legal review processesDevelop, maintain and improve strong internal processes and documentation working across the Finance, Legal and Market Access teamsMaintain calendar and matrix of bids/offers and coordinate communication of contract development and execution statusFacilitate the transition of executed contracts to the appropriate operational team for implementation and/or adjudication, including outlining key terms and providing detailed explanations, as necessaryProvide insights to the business that inform GTN forecasting, contracting, and pricing decisions and strategies, and general business planningStrong cross functional collaboration in support of internal contract processing, review, and reportingAssist Account Managers with ad-hoc analysis, business planning, and contract performance reviewUse financial models to perform and verify calculations for business scenarios, as neededAdvise on strategic and operational issues and requirements related to contract administration including any matters relating to rebate analysis and payments, as well as resolution of disputes on rebate claimsKnowledge and Skills:Progressive business experience in finance, accounting, sales, government pricing, contracting, or other related areaUnderstanding of pharmaceutical pricing government programs and associated regulations and the ability to determine the impact of contracts on themHighly analytical and detail oriented, with the ability to define problems, research proposed solutions, analyze the short- and long-term implications, propose and present the results to key stakeholders and implement solutionsAdvanced Microsoft Excel, Word and PowerPoint skillsSuperior organizational and project management skills as well as polished written and verbal communication skillsExcellent interpersonal skills, customer service commitment, and detail orientation with the ability to work across the organization and external subject matter expertsBe self-motivated, requiring minimal supervision, and able to contribute as a team playerAbility to multitask, shift gears and pivot when necessary, and be comfortable working under constant deadlinesDeep working knowledge of the pharmaceutical and managed care industry including market dynamics and the competitive landscape of formulary coverage, market share and profitabilityEducation and Experience:Bachelor’s Degree in a business discipline requiredTypically requires 8 years minimum experience in payer contracting, contract administration and/or analytics experience in the Pharmaceutical, Life Science or related Industries or the equivalent combination of education and experiencePay Range:$0 - $0Disclosure Statement:The range provided is based on what we believe is a reasonable estimate for the base salary pay range for this job at the time of posting.
